The Utica Pioneers are composed of 27 teams representing Utica University in intercollegiate athletics, including men and women's basketball, cross country, golf, ice hockey, lacrosse, soccer, swimming & diving, tennis, track and field, and wrestling.
Women's sports include field hockey, gymnastics, softball, volleyball, and water polo.
The men's and women's ice hockey teams compete as members of the United Collegiate Hockey Conference, and the women's water polo team competes as a member of the Collegiate Water Polo Association[2] Utica University offers 29 NCAA Division III intercollegiate sports.
[4] The football, field hockey, soccer and lacrosse teams play in Charles A. Gaetano Stadium.
The men's hockey team led the nation in Division III home attendance in the 2006–07 and 2007–08 seasons.
